形容词 adj.
  1. Unsuccessful, failed. idiomatic
    — Their efforts were in vain and he succumbed to his injuries.
副词 adv.
  1. Without success or a result; ending in failure. idiomatic
    — […]that we here highly resolve that these dead shall not have died in vain[…]
  2. In a disrespectful manner, without honoring the proper meaning; insincerely or without proper respect. idiomatic
    — Thou ſhalt not take the Name of the Lord thy God in vaine:[…]
